Yamamoto again stood at the podium in a row and got 2nd position in the point ranking!

Series name: 2013 Japanese Championship SUPER FORMULA Round3
Event name: 2013 Japanese Championship SUPER FORMULA Round3 FUJI SPEEDWAY
Course: 4.563km × 55 laps (250.965km)
Qualifying: 2013-07-13 Sat / Fine / Attendance 8,900 (Announcement from the organizer)
Race: 2013-07-14 Sun / Fine / Attendance 15,700 (Announcement from the organizer)

Japanese Championship SUPER FORMULA Round3 was held at FUJI SPEEDWAY. TEAM MUGEN participated in this race with drivers, #16 Naoki Yamamoto and #15 Takashi Kobayashi. #16 Naoki Yamamoto won 3rd prize at previous race and is currently ranked at 2nd position (there are two drivers in the 2nd position including #16 Yamamoto) only 1 point behind the champion.


█   Race
#16 Naoki Yamamoto 3rd place (55 laps: 1hr27mins41.363secs / Best lap: 1min27.511secs)
#15 Takashi Kobayashi 15th place (55 laps: 1hr28mins21.238secs / Best lap: 1min27.742secs.)

At 2:15pm with the sun shining between shallow clouds the race started just after a formation lap. Soon after some accident occurred at the back and a safety car appeared even the first lap was not finished. At this point #16 Yamamoto was in 8th position and #15 Kobayashi was in 15th position.

The race itself restarted from 6th lap and while the safety car was on the course, some leading cars made a pit stop for gas and the second machine was imposed on the drive-through penalty. So then in the end #16 Yamamoto went up in the ranking to the 5th position and #15 Kobayashi did to the 13th position at the 7th lap.

#16 Yamamoto made a pit stop just after finishing 30th lap for gas and tire change. He went down to the 10th position temporally, however, marked his best record and kept a good pace. On the other hand, #15 Kobayashi made a pit stop after finishing 33rd laps for gas and tire change and went back to the course.

By the time when all the machines finished pit stop, #16 Yamamoto was in the 6th position and #15 Kobayashi in the 16th position. #16 Yamamoto chased after the machine in front and at the 42nd laps while the machines in the 4th and the 5th positions competed he dived into inside of the machine in its 5th position a t the hairpin curve and got the 5th position.

At the 43rd lap the driver at the 2nd position received the drive-through penalty and at the 53rd lap just before the goal, due to a machine trouble, the machine at the 2nd position stopped, and then #16 Yamamoto went up to the 3rd position and finished the race with 3rd position following the 3rd place in the 2RD at AUTOPOLIS.

As the result of this race the total points of #16 Yamamoto at this series is 17 and gets the solely 2nd position. The next race will be held at the home ground of Yamamoto, TWIN RING MOTEGI, Tochigi prefecture at August 3rd and 4th.

█ Comment from the team director Tezuka

We could start off the qualifying with a decent condition, and went far to Q3. Our engineers and drivers did their best and got 7th position 3 seconds behind the top machine. There must something, something is lacking for winning the race, but at this point I am satisfied with this result. I am so relieved that because the 2nd set of the tires worked very well and the operation at the pit worked also very well we could win a 3rd prize of the race at FUJI which we normally not do well. I admit that we could not get this result without luck but still our driver passed by one car by his own.

Considering the position of Kobayashi at the qualifying, we set up the goal, completion of the race which he could not in the previous race at the AUTOPOLIS. He seemed to learn a lot about the characteristics of our machine even this was just a second race this year for him. I hope he can get a better result for the next race. In general though this time we tried new strategy and did our very best, we could not win, that means there still is something remaining lacking and no to be competed. We would like to try new strategy and win the next race. Since next race will be held at TWIN RING MOTEGI, a home ground course for Yamamoto, we come together to do our best to let Yamamoto stand the center of the podium.
